August 3, 2010Wisdom from Inception quote: Dreams / perspectives feel real. Experience them and then wake up
In the movie Inception, Cobb says:
“Dreams feel real while we’re in them. It’s only when we wake up that we realize something was actually strange.”
Conversations can be the same way. We can be completely convinced while we listen. It all makes sense. It’s only once we “wake up” and view the points from an outside perspective that we recognize that something was strange. Or perhaps just missing.
The best movies have us thinking about what was missing long after we see them. We’re not negating them as much as we are expanding on them. The dream levels in Inception were way more rule-based and linear than my dreams. That got me thinking about my dreams.
The best conversations are the same way. They get us thinking and expanding on what they say. I’m listening to an audio that is stunning me with it’s brilliance. My reflections lead me to areas where I think beyond the points in the audio.
Let yourself be immersed in a perspective and take it in in its wholeness. Just remember to wake up when it’s over. Not to negate that world – just to not be limited to it.
